About Javier Carreras

Javier Carreras is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Biochemistry and Pharmaceutical Science, having authored 32 papers that have together received 1.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Catalytic Alkyne Reactions (13 papers), Cyclopropane Reaction Mechanisms (11 papers) and Catalytic C–H Functionalization Methods (10 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Organic Chemistry (1.1k citations), Inorganic Chemistry (366 citations) and Process Chemistry and Technology (40 citations). Javier Carreras has collaborated with scholars based in Spain, Germany and Israel. Frequent co-authors include Manuel Alcarazo, Walter Thiel, Pedro J. Pérez, Ana Caballero, Richard Goddard, Antonio M. Echavarren, Mahendra Patil, Blanca Inés, Jekaterina Petuškova and Madeleine Livendahl.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Angewandte Chemie International Edition and The Journal of Organic Chemistry.
